TICKET-5519: Shrinkbatch CLI auth failures

Customers running the Shrinkbatch CLI for batch image resizing are hitting 403s on every job since this morning. Cause: the shared credential the CLI uses against the internal resize farm expired. Local resizing unaffected; only cloud batch mode fails. Fix shipped in config update 3.4.1 — customers on older versions need the manual workaround. When walking a customer through it, have them set the key below.

gateway credential: kto3_qfe

## Support

So the Crunchbarn transcoding farm mostly runs itself, but when it doesn't, start with the worker health page and the dead-letter queue. Nine times out of ten a stuck job just needs a requeue. If you hit something weirder — codec mismatches, nodes flapping — don't suffer alone. Drop a note to the farm maintainers' inbox.

escalation mailbox, bafog-fafog: ulador@paliqlabs.internal

Handover — StageGrid seat-map renderer

Hey Tomas, passing the Orpheum Hall renderer work to you. The SVG layer is solid; the zoom-on-hover bug is in branch fix/row-labels, PR awaiting your review. Staging credentials are rotated, so you'll need to unseal the render config vault with the passphrase below.

unlock words, yawig-kagef: gordor-holvan-ulaael-pramir-ulaiel-tamdor